The Undergraduate Certificate in Hazardous Material Handling is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ills required to safely handle hazardous materials in various industries.
This program focuses on teaching students how to identify, assess, and mitigate risks associated with hazardous materials, ensuring a safe working environment for everyone.
Upon completion of the program, students will be able to demonstrate their understanding of hazardous material handling principles, including regulations, safety protocols, and emergency response procedures.
The duration of the Undergraduate Certificate in Hazardous Material Handling typically ranges from 6 to 12 months, depending on the institution and the student's prior experience.
The program is highly relevant to industries such as construction, manufacturing, and transportation, where hazardous materials are commonly used.
By completing this certificate, students can enhance their career prospects in fields such as environmental management, safety management, and logistics.
The knowledge and skills gained through this program can also be applied to roles such as hazardous materials handler, safety inspector, or environmental consultant.
